Opinion
C. A. 9th Cir. The parties are requested to file further memoranda on the following questions:
(1) Must Congress authorize or ratify the withdrawal . of territorial lands by the President?;
(2) If so, did Executive Order No. 8979 have the necessary authorization or ratification?; and
(3) Was this matter adequately raised below?
